Output 609b8807838e7bd2efa16acc017dee58a4e6e3d90510696b950b3a9fa56bb297:5

value
41672577
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9918bf427da5e1847616086f930c7711a372b593 OP_EQUAL
address
MMrfGEqqbPhB1JrFPHCcz8tB7E29nJFgz4
transaction
609b8807838e7bd2efa16acc017dee58a4e6e3d90510696b950b3a9fa56bb297
spent
true